Spaces:
Running
Running
Update app.py
Browse files
app.py
CHANGED
@@ -2,7 +2,6 @@
|
|
2 |
import gradio as gr
|
3 |
from transformers import pipeline
|
4 |
import re
|
5 |
-
import langid
|
6 |
import numpy as np
|
7 |
import pandas as pd
|
8 |
|
@@ -44,7 +43,6 @@ def run_benchmark():
|
|
44 |
gen_output = gen_model(prompt, max_new_tokens=100, do_sample=True)[0]['generated_text'].strip()
|
45 |
valid = is_palindrome(gen_output)
|
46 |
cleaned_len = len(clean_text(gen_output))
|
47 |
-
detected_lang = langid.classify(gen_output)[0]
|
48 |
|
49 |
scores = []
|
50 |
for rater in rater_models:
|
@@ -63,8 +61,7 @@ def run_benchmark():
|
|
63 |
"Valid": "✅" if valid else "❌",
|
64 |
"Length": cleaned_len,
|
65 |
"Grammar Score": avg_score,
|
66 |
-
"Final Score": final_score
|
67 |
-
"Detected Lang": detected_lang
|
68 |
})
|
69 |
|
70 |
df = pd.DataFrame(results).sort_values(by="Final Score", ascending=False).reset_index(drop=True)
|
|
|
2 |
import gradio as gr
|
3 |
from transformers import pipeline
|
4 |
import re
|
|
|
5 |
import numpy as np
|
6 |
import pandas as pd
|
7 |
|
|
|
43 |
gen_output = gen_model(prompt, max_new_tokens=100, do_sample=True)[0]['generated_text'].strip()
|
44 |
valid = is_palindrome(gen_output)
|
45 |
cleaned_len = len(clean_text(gen_output))
|
|
|
46 |
|
47 |
scores = []
|
48 |
for rater in rater_models:
|
|
|
61 |
"Valid": "✅" if valid else "❌",
|
62 |
"Length": cleaned_len,
|
63 |
"Grammar Score": avg_score,
|
64 |
+
"Final Score": final_score
|
|
|
65 |
})
|
66 |
|
67 |
df = pd.DataFrame(results).sort_values(by="Final Score", ascending=False).reset_index(drop=True)
|